- Know What Type of Beef Jerky You Prefer
Before buying beef jerky in bulk, it’s essential to know what type of jerky suits your taste. Beef jerky comes in many varieties, from traditional to gourmet flavors. You may want to consider factors such as:
- Flavor Profile: Do you prefer sweet, spicy, or smoky flavors? Some jerky is marinated in BBQ sauce, while others are seasoned with pepper, teriyaki, or chili for a more intense flavor.
- Texture: Jerky can be chewy, tender, or even crispy. Consider whether you like your jerky tough or more easy to bite into.
- Cut of Meat: Jerky can be made from various cuts of beef, such as flank steak, brisket, or round. The cut affects the tenderness and flavor.
Understanding your preferences will help you narrow down your search for bulk jerky and make sure you’re satisfied with your purchase.
- Consider Quality and Ingredients
Not all beef jerky is created equal, and when buying in bulk, you want to ensure you’re getting high-quality jerky that’s both delicious and nutritious. Look for jerky brands that use high-quality beef and simple, natural ingredients. Many jerky brands add preservatives, artificial flavorings, or excessive sodium, which may not be ideal for your health.
When browsing bulk beef jerky, consider the following:
- Grass-fed Beef: Jerky made from grass-fed beef often offers a more natural taste and higher nutritional value.
- No Artificial Additives: Choose brands that avoid adding artificial colors, preservatives, or flavors.
- Low Sodium: Opt for jerky that’s low in sodium if you’re concerned about your salt intake.
- Non-GMO Ingredients: If you prefer non-GMO food, look for jerky brands that advertise non-GMO ingredients.
By focusing on quality, you’ll not only enjoy a better-tasting product but also make a healthier choice.
- Research Bulk Purchasing Options
When buying beef jerky in bulk, you have several purchasing options, each with its pros and cons. Some of the most common methods are:
- Online Retailers: Websites like Amazon, Beef Jerky Outlet, and Jerky.com often offer bulk buying options. Purchasing from online stores can give you access to a wide variety of jerky brands, flavors, and cuts. Additionally, you can read customer reviews to help you make an informed decision. However, shipping fees and delivery times may vary depending on the supplier.
- Specialty Jerky Stores: Some brick-and-mortar jerky shops offer bulk options, allowing you to buy jerky in large quantities. These stores often offer samples, so you can taste before committing to a larger order.
- Wholesale Suppliers: If you’re looking to buy beef jerky in very large quantities, such as for events or businesses, consider wholesale jerky suppliers. These companies specialize in large orders and can offer significant discounts for bulk purchases.
- Subscription Services: Some jerky brands offer subscription services where you can receive bulk orders of jerky at regular intervals. Subscriptions may give you discounts, and you can try different jerky flavors each time.
- Compare Prices and Shipping Costs
One of the key advantages of buying in bulk is saving money. However, to truly make sure you’re getting the best deal, compare prices between different vendors. Prices can vary widely, even for the same brand and product, so doing a little research can help you find the most cost-effective option.
Additionally, keep an eye on shipping costs. While some retailers offer free shipping on large orders, others might charge a premium for delivery, especially on bulk purchases. Factor in these extra costs when calculating the overall price of your bulk jerky purchase.

- Store Your Bulk Beef Jerky Properly
Once you’ve bought your bulk wholesale beef jerky for resale it’s important to store it properly to ensure it stays fresh. Beef jerky can have a long shelf life, but it still requires proper storage.
- Keep It Sealed: If you buy jerky in large quantities, make sure it’s stored in airtight bags or containers to maintain freshness.
- Cool, Dry Place: Store your jerky in a cool, dry place to avoid it from becoming too tough or spoiling.
- Freeze for Long-Term Storage: If you’re planning to keep the jerky for an extended period, freezing it can help preserve its flavor and texture.
